This soup, served hot in a shot glass, is wonderfully warming, and the spicy heat from the chiles will wake up your taste buds. It's a great way to kick-start some festive conversation.

Cooks' note:

Soup can be blended and cream added (but not heated) 1 day ahead and chilled, covered. Thin with broth and season with salt when reheating if necessary.
